This review is from: Judith Baker Montano's Embroidery & Craz: 180+ Stitches & Combinations Tips for Needles, Thread, Ribbon, Fabric Illustrations for Left-Handed & Right-Handed Stitching (Paperback)
This book offers good, detailed, easy to follow instructions for the stitches. I was disappointed that the book was so small in size. I may have missed the measurements in the book info, but it is only about 6" X 6". I thought it was going to be a bit larger. Also the spiral binding is on the top and when you flip the pages open and look at the pages, the printing on the top page will be upside down to you and the bottom page will be right side up. So, as you are reading the instructions for a stitch, as you progress to the next page you have to flip the book around to read the instructions.

This review is from: Judith Baker Montano's Embroidery & Craz: 180+ Stitches & Combinations Tips for Needles, Thread, Ribbon, Fabric Illustrations for Left-Handed & Right-Handed Stitching (Paperback)
I used this book in a sewing class and I loved it. All of the amazing stitches are in an alphabetical picture index in the front of the book. Each stitch has the page number right by it. The best part is that when you turn to the stitch that you want, it has very simple word and picture directions for both left and right handers! My lefty friends were very happy. You can also turn the pages on the spiral binding and set the book up like a small easel for ease of reading while you sew. Just a lovely book. Well worth the money to anyone who loves embroidery.
